The solution

A daily operations layer for location, alerts, and accountability

Deploy 4G GPS trackers (wired, OBD, or battery based on vehicle type) and manage live operations from one dashboard. You get real-time position, exception alerts, and route playback with timestamps so dispatch, customer support, and management work from the same evidence.

  • Live location on one map — 4G updates every few seconds so dispatch sees speed, direction, and idle status without refreshing five tabs.
  • Geofences that people actually use — Draw zones for depots, customer sites, or restricted areas. Get SMS or email the moment a vehicle enters or leaves.
  • Trip playback with timestamps — Replay any day’s route: stops, deviations, and timing—useful for customer queries, RTO questions, or internal reviews.

How it works

From install to insight

From installation to live monitoring, the workflow is simple enough for operations and technical teams to adopt quickly.

Step 1

Install & connect

Fit the device to the vehicle—wired, OBD, or battery as needed.

Step 2

Sync to the cloud

GPS and events stream securely so nothing depends on manual updates.

Step 3

Use one portal

Maps, reports, and alerts in the same login—web and mobile.

A GPS unit is installed on each vehicle (wired, OBD, or battery model based on use case). The device captures location and movement signals, then transmits data over 4G to the cloud platform. Dispatch and operations teams monitor live maps, configure alert rules, and review route playback from web or mobile. Typical installation is 1-2 hours per vehicle, followed by dashboard onboarding for your team.

It is GPS-based monitoring of where your vehicles are, how fast they’re moving, and how they behave on the road. Data goes over cellular networks to a cloud platform where you view maps, set geofences, and receive alerts—no need to phone the driver for every update.
Under normal conditions our 4G trackers typically land within about 5–10 metres. In urban canyons with good sky view it can be tighter. Update frequency is usually every 10–60 seconds depending on how you configure the device.
Yes. Our commercial-grade hardware is designed for Indian operating conditions including temperature variation, vibration, and long duty cycles. Final suitability depends on vehicle type and deployment objective, which is validated during rollout planning.
Cars, trucks, buses, two-wheelers, and many commercial body types. We offer wired installs, OBD plug-ins, and battery-powered options where wiring isn’t practical.
Installation is typically one to two hours per vehicle in cities we cover. Once the device is live, your dashboard can show data within about a day of install.
Yes—Android and iOS apps for tracking, alerts, and reports on the move. Geofence and map features match what you get on the web.
